1. The Basics of Drywall


Drywall, also known as sheetrock or gypsum board, is a popular building material used to create walls and ceilings. It consists of a gypsum core wrapped in paper, making it easy to install and finish. Drywall panels are available in various sizes and thicknesses to suit different project needs.

5. DIY Drywall Repair


For minor drywall damage, you can attempt DIY repairs. Fill nail holes or small dents with joint compound, sand the area smooth, and paint over it. However, more extensive repairs may require the expertise of a professional drywall contractor.
